I recently purchased the Samyang 14mm F2.8 lens with the idea of running off some milky way shots this winter. This is the first result. A stack of 14 x 180s images (tracked) taken with the lens on a Canon 60Da. Mount is a HEQ5 Pro. Tracked images were stacked and processed in Pixinsight and then combined with a single, untracked, foreground shot in PS CS6.

Link to astrobin image here. (https://astrob.in/full/337695/0/)

The glow above the foreground is light from nearby built up areas.
